Researchers seek clues about rare muscle disease in caribbean community
NCT ID NCT07265999
Summary
This study aims to understand why dermatomyositis, a rare autoimmune disease affecting skin and muscles, appears to be more severe in Caribbean populations. Researchers will observe 10 patients in Guadeloupe to identify factors linked to worse outcomes. The study involves observation only—no new treatments are being tested—with the goal of improving future care strategies.
